Abstract
This article appraises Ben Enwonwu’s contribution to postcolonial modernism in Nigeria. To do so, it analyses his artistic responses to the political crisis that resulted in the Nigeria-Biafra war (1967–70). The article argues that Enwonwu’s varied Biafrascapes, expressed as portraits, landscape paintings and mythopoetic imagery, reflect his struggle to ethically convey the conflict’s complex realities and legacies.
